About SOS!SEN
SOS!SEN is an independent UK charity dedicated to helping families secure the right educational support for children and young people with SEND. Our team of over 70 volunteers with firsthand experience provides legally-based advice and practical guidance to confidently navigate the SEND system. We support parents, carers, and young people through every phase of their journey. With a 95% success rate at Tribunal and 1,400 helpline calls answered yearly, we empower all children to reach their full potential through the provisions they deserve. We also raise awareness of SEND challenges through training, campaigning, and lobbying, ensuring that legal duties to children are fulfilled.

We’re Looking for an Administrator Volunteer

Location: Remote
Time Commitment: 5+ hours a week
Start Date: February 2025 (flexible)

Join us as an Administrator Volunteer supporting our busy administration team to assist families and individuals navigating SEND (Special Educational Needs and Disabilities) challenges. This rewarding role enables you to make a meaningful difference by strengthening our community connections.

Skills and Qualifications:

  • Proficient in IT systems (particularly Microsoft).
  • Strong organisational skills.
  • Clear written ability with excellent communication skills.
  • Ability to multitask.
  • Work to deadlines and under pressure.
  • Good attention to detail.
  • Friendly, can-do attitude; ability to work as part of a team.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Processing Stripe payments and sending out webinar links; recording transactions on a monthly spreadsheet.
  • Printing and posting booklets (if working from the office is viable) and updating the petty cash spreadsheet.
  • Managing guest lists for live webinars and sending links to attendees.
  • Entering upcoming events on Volunteers SharePoint.
  • Updating the PAP waiting list, emailing parents/carers to check their ongoing needs, and recording responses on Apricot.
  • Emailing reminders and venue details to parents/carers registered for advice centres on Apricot.
  • Chasing overdue invoices and adding notes to Xero.
  • Recording monthly advice centre attendance.
  • Processing registrations on Apricot and sending follow-up emails.
  • Organising digital folders/files.
  • Supporting other administrative tasks to ensure the charity runs smoothly.
